Naira recovers, gains N1.24 at official market

2 months ago
by Sami Tunji

The Naira on Wednesday appreciated at the official market trading at N1,379.46 against the US dollar.

According to data released on the official website of the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N), the Naira gained N1.24.

This represents a 0.09 per cent gain when compared to Tuesday when the local currency traded at N1,380.70 to the dollar.

The Naira which had been on almost two weeks decline before appreciating on Wednesday traded at N1,364.23 on Monday.
